    Growth of North Bangalore as a Real Estate Hub

    Introduction: The Rise of North Bangalore

    North Bangalore has rapidly evolved from a tranquil suburb to a vibrant real estate hub, attracting both homebuyers and investors. With its strategic location, robust infrastructure, proximity to the Kempegowda International Airport, and a surge in commercial developments, North Bangalore is now one of the most sought-after regions in the city. The transformation over the past decade has been remarkable, turning this once-quiet area into a prime destination for residential and commercial growth.

    Strategic Connectivity Driving Real Estate Growth

    One of the primary factors fueling the real estate boom in North Bangalore is its excellent connectivity. The region is well-connected to the rest of the city through major highways like the Outer Ring Road, Bellary Road (NH 44), and the upcoming Peripheral Ring Road. The presence of the Namma Metro, as well as multiple BMTC bus routes, has made commuting easier and more efficient. This seamless connectivity has significantly increased the attractiveness of North Bangalore for both businesses and residents.

    Kempegowda International Airport: A Game Changer

    The establishment of the Kempegowda International Airport in Devanahalli has been a major catalyst for the development of North Bangalore. The airport has not only improved accessibility but also attracted a plethora of commercial and hospitality projects. The influx of business travelers, tourists, and professionals has created a surge in demand for residential properties, hotels, and serviced apartments. This airport-centric development has positioned North Bangalore as a global gateway for the city.

    Commercial Growth and Employment Opportunities

    North Bangalore is witnessing an unprecedented rise in commercial activity. Business parks and tech corridors, such as Manyata Tech Park and KIADB Aerospace Park, have established the region as a thriving employment hub. The presence of multinational companies, IT giants, and start-ups has generated thousands of job opportunities, drawing professionals from across the country. This influx of young, dynamic talent has, in turn, boosted the demand for quality housing and lifestyle amenities in the area.

    Residential Developments: Catering to Modern Lifestyles

    The real estate landscape in North Bangalore is characterized by a diverse range of residential projects. From luxury villas and gated communities to high-rise apartments and affordable housing, the region offers options for various income groups and preferences. Reputed developers like Brigade Group, Prestige Group, Sobha, and Godrej Properties have launched landmark projects, ensuring high construction quality and modern amenities. Green spaces, landscaped gardens, and recreational facilities are integral to many new developments, appealing to families and young professionals alike.

    Infrastructure Upgrades and Future Projects

    Infrastructure development has been a cornerstone of North Bangalore’s growth story. The government’s focus on enhancing road networks, expanding metro lines, and improving civic amenities has played a crucial role. Notable projects like the Bangalore International Convention Centre, Devanahalli Business Park, and Aerospace SEZ are set to further boost the region’s profile. These upgrades are expected to attract more investments and foster a sustainable, well-planned urban ecosystem.

    Educational and Healthcare Facilities

    Another key driver of North Bangalore’s real estate growth is the presence of reputed educational institutions and healthcare centers. Esteemed schools like Canadian International School, Vidyashilp Academy, and Delhi Public School have established campuses in the region, making it a preferred choice for families. Leading hospitals, including Columbia Asia, Aster CMI, and Baptist Hospital, offer world-class medical care, enhancing the overall livability quotient.

    Emergence of Retail and Lifestyle Destinations

    North Bangalore is fast becoming a lifestyle hotspot, thanks to the rise of shopping malls, entertainment centers, fine-dining restaurants, and cafes. Malls like RMZ Galleria, Elements Mall, and upcoming retail complexes provide a wide array of shopping and leisure options. The area’s vibrant social infrastructure is attracting a cosmopolitan crowd, transforming North Bangalore into a bustling urban center with a dynamic lifestyle.

    Sustainable Development and Green Initiatives

    With rapid urbanization, sustainability has become a focal point in North Bangalore’s real estate development. Many builders are adopting eco-friendly practices, incorporating rainwater harvesting, solar panels, waste management systems, and green building materials. The region’s relatively lower population density and abundant green cover, especially around Jakkur Lake and Yelahanka, further enhance its appeal for those seeking a healthy, balanced lifestyle.

    Property Appreciation and Investment Potential

    North Bangalore has emerged as a promising investment destination, with property values showing steady appreciation over the years. The consistent demand for rental properties, driven by the influx of professionals and expatriates, ensures healthy rental yields. Upcoming infrastructure projects and continued commercial growth are likely to push prices higher, making it an attractive option for long-term investors. Real estate experts predict that North Bangalore will continue to outperform other regions in terms of return on investment.

    Challenges and the Road Ahead

    Despite its many advantages, North Bangalore faces challenges such as traffic congestion during peak hours and the need for more robust public transport options in certain pockets. Addressing these issues through enhanced planning and public-private partnerships will be crucial to sustaining balanced growth. However, the region’s proactive approach to development and the presence of forward-thinking stakeholders offer hope for timely solutions.

    Conclusion: The Future of North Bangalore Real Estate

    North Bangalore’s transformation into a real estate hub is a testament to its strategic advantages, robust infrastructure, and dynamic urban planning. The region’s blend of connectivity, commercial vibrancy, quality housing, and lifestyle amenities make it a compelling choice for both end-users and investors. As North Bangalore continues to attract investments and develop into a self-sustaining urban center, it is poised to shape Bangalore’s real estate landscape for years to come.
